German Companies Aaronia and Inova Semiconductors GmbH Part Of Innovative Demonstrations In Analog Devices Booth at electronica
October 09 2012 - 8:00AM
Business Wire
Germany-based companies Aaronia AG and Inova Semiconductors will
participate in product demonstrations in the Analog Devices, Inc.
(ADI) booth at electronica 2012 in Munich, November 13-16 (Hall A4
Stand 159). Aaronia, based in Euscheid, will showcase its newest
hand-held RF spectrum analyzer with a “treasure hunt” allowing show
attendees to use the Spectran V5 spectrum analyzer to find RF
devices. Next-generation infotainment and driver assistance systems
in vehicles integrated with a smart phone will be demonstrated
using Munich-based Inova’s APIX2 (Automotive PIXel Link)
technology.

About Vehicle Infotainment Smart Phone Integration
A multi-zone infotainment system demonstrating smartphone
integration and in-car distribution of high-definition content
using Inova’s APIX2 technology will be featured in ADI’s booth.
APIX2 meets automotive requirements for EMI and cost efficiency
while transmitting two uncompressed high-definition video streams,
multi-channel audio and 100Mbits/s Ethernet data over a single
4-wire shielded twisted-pair cable. The demonstration features
video conferencing and touch surfaces in remote displays via
standard Ethernet protocols and the integration of real-time user
interfaces and applications using HDMI connectivity to smart
phones.
